Contemporary Art Society for Wales' free public lectures

Post categories:

Laura Chamberlain Laura Chamberlain | 14:10 UK time, Tuesday, 21 September 2010

The opens its autumn/winter series of free public lectures this evening.

Tonight's lecture, on Woven Sculptures, will be given by artist at the Cardiff University School of Architecture, King Edward VII Avenue, Cardiff.

Further planned lectures next month are set to include a talk by Professor Sioned Davies, head of the School of Welsh at Cardiff University, on Illustrating the Mabinogion, while Peter Spriggs will deliver a lecture entitled 'Continuing to make art and trying to make it better'.
